Facts about Input interior
Business areas
Input interior operates within four business areas: offices and private businesses, hotels and restaurants, schools and educational environments, and hospitals and care facilities.
Company structure
Input interior is a privately-owned group. From 2018, EFG’s interior design operations also form part of the Input interior group.
Local offices / showrooms
Input interior have showrooms at 41 locations in the Nordic region.
Employees
The company’s workforce currently numbers around 560 dedicated employees.
Number of projects
Our employees carry out over 6,000 projects a year worldwide.
Turnover
Input interior has a turnover of approximately 300 millions EUR.
Founded
Input interior was founded in 1987 by Sune Lundqvist. Find out more about our history.
